More than 100 of the organization's 125 membershad not been present the previous year when theexecutive board had been elected. A small cliqueled by Charles G. Sellers '45, Abraham P. Goldblum'46 and Maurice C. Benewitz '47 gathered the nightof Oct. 2 to plan an anti-Communist coup...
...group meeting the next day, theyportrayed the AYD-heir to the Young CommunistsLeague-as an undemocratic organization and wonsupport for the election of a new board. WilliamH. Bozman '46 replaced AYD member Harry A.Mendelsohn '48 as HLU president; three otherofficers were also deposed...
...ground, the exodus continues. At a bus station in Pristina, about 100 Albanians, mostly old women, waited last Tuesday to board for the 60-mile drive to Skopje in Macedonia. An Albanian woman whispered that the trip cost 20 deutsche marks (almost $11) and took about four hours. With a Serbian army escort urging visitors to clear the area because "it is too dangerous," the woman was asked why she was leaving. The escort interjected, "Because of NATO bombs, right?"
